It's been confirmed that the HSE Ambulance Service will operate in Millstreet on a full time basis from September. 

The ambulance service was withdrawn in December 2012 and was replaced by a Rapid Response Vehicle manned by a single paramedic per shift. 

The move was met with considerable opposition at the time leading to repeated calls for the service to be restored.

A recent review carried out by the HSE found Rapid Response Vehicles in areas such as Millstreet should be replaced by a transporting Ambulance.
